The Australian Shepherd, also known as the “Ghost Eye Dog”, is one of the best herding dogs out there. Australian Shepherd were not developed in Australian but in America. They made great companies and they are very fast learning. People use them to herd their sheep, cattle, and ducks on their farms. Their likely to please their owners and are highly regarded for their skills in obediences. I rise and show Aussies in showmanship, agility, and obedience. They are very fast learners and you can train them at a younger age or you can train them when they are older too.
